Graph the line with slope -3/4 passing through the point (4,3)

Explanation:

The slope is rise/run = -3/4

The line passes through (4, 3)

The run is 4, we add 4 to the x-coordinate

The rise is -3, we add -3 to the y-coordinate

We have:

(4 + 4, 3 - 3) = (8, 0)

We use (4, 3) and (8, 0) to graph the line
